Transaction 33fa015889056c50f30d855badf706b52e84d196ccf3229a0ab61ef8722a48d7
1 Input
1 Output
-
33fa015889056c50f30d855badf706b52e84d196ccf3229a0ab61ef8722a48d7:0
- value
- 7468215
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1509f8a1dbc1309c781f1719c75d1cd25fe1678
- address
- bc1q79gflzsahsfsn3up79cecaw3e5jlu9ncfvks4c